v36_1308 - GALLIA BELGICA - SEQUANI (Area of Besançon) Denier SEQVANOIOTVOS

GALLIA BELGICA - SEQUANI (Area of Besançon) Denier SEQVANOIOTVOS VF/XF
MONNAIES 36 (2008)
Starting price : 140.00 €
Estimate : 220.00 €
Realised price : 230.00 €
Number of bids : 3
Maximum bid : 235.00 €
Type : Denier SEQVANOIOTVOS
Date: c. 70-50 AC.
Metal : silver
Diameter : 13 mm
Orientation dies : 3 h.
Weight : 1,49 g.
Rarity : R2
Coments on the condition:
Exemplaire sur un flan un peu court et ovale. Frappe relativement centrée des deux côtés. Patine grise légèrement poreuse
Catalogue references :

Obverse


Obverse legend : ANÉPIGRAPHE.
Obverse description : Tête imberbe à gauche, les cheveux disposés en boucles perlées sur deux rangées ; un rinceau derrière la tête.

Reverse


Reverse legend : SEQ]VANO[IO]//TV[OS].
Reverse description : Sanglier à gauche.

Commentary


Bien que sur un flan trop court, le visage est complet. Au revers, le sanglier est lui aussi complet avec une partie de la légende visible. Ces deniers sont rarement bien frappés, et souvent sur des flan fourrés !.
Although on a flan that is too short, the face is complete. On the reverse, the boar is also complete with part of the legend visible. These deniers are rarely well struck, and often on filled flans!

Historical background


GALLIA BELGICA - SEQUANI (Area of Besançon)

(2nd - 1st century BC)

The Séquanes were one of the most important peoples of eastern Gaul. They were the enemies of the Aedui, their neighbors. Their territory was very vast and extended between the Saône, the Rhône, the Jura and the Vosges. The Jura lakes separated them from the Helvetians. They had been very powerful in the 3rd and 2nd centuries BC, but had lost their luster after the Germans had occupied part of their territory around 70 BC. Their neighbors were the Leuques, the Lingones, Aedui and Helvetians. Their principal oppidum was Vesontio (Besançon). Mentioned several times by Caesar, during the campaign of 52 BC, they provided a contingent of 12,000 men for the relief army. Caesar (BG. I, 1-3, 6, 8-10, 12, 19, 31-33, 35, 38, 40, 44, 48, 54; IV, 10; VI, 12; VII, 66, 67, 75, 90). Kruta: 16, 71, 111, 364.
